当前位置: 首页> 科普在线> 正文

减法运算的并行处理策略

中视教育资讯网官网(educcutv)教育新闻在线讯

减法运算的并行处理策略主要是为了提高计算效率,减少运算时间。这种策略在面对大数减法运算时尤为重要,因为它在许多领域都有广泛的应用,如金融、密码学、科学计算、工程计算等。

1. 利用多核处理器并行实现

2减法运算的并行处理策略

将大数分解成多个子数字,并将每个子数字分配到不同的核心上进行运算。使用同步机制协调各个核心之间的计算,确保减法运算的正确性。通过优化数据结构和算法来提高并行效率,例如使用多级缓存来减少内存访问时间。

2. 利用图形处理器(GPU)并行实现

将大数分解成多个子数字,并将每个子数字映射到GPU的多个线程上进行运算。使用GPU的并行计算能力同时对多个子数字进行减法运算,大幅提高计算速度。通过优化数据格式和算法来提高GPU的并行效率,例如使用共享内存来减少数据传输时间。

3. 利用分布式计算平台并行实现

将大数分解成多个子数字,并将每个子数字分配到不同的计算节点上进行运算。使用消息传递机制在计算节点之间交换数据和同步计算结果,确保减法运算的正确性。通过优化数据分区策略和通信算法来提高分布式计算的并行效率,例如使用数据复制技术来减少数据传输量。

4. 利用云计算平台并行实现

将大数分解成多个子数字,并将每个子数字分配到云计算平台上的不同虚拟机上进行运算。使用云计算平台提供的分布式计算服务进行减法运算,通过弹性扩展计算资源来满足不同规模的计算需求。通过优化虚拟机配置和网络通信来提高云计算平台的并行效率,例如使用高性能网络技术来减少数据传输时间。

5. 利用量子计算并行实现

将大数分解成多个量子比特,并将每个量子比特表示成量子态。利用量子计算的并行性对多个量子比特同时进行减法运算,大幅提高计算速度。通过优化量子算法来提高量子计算的并行效率,例如使用量子纠缠技术来加快计算过程。

6. 利用新型并行计算技术并行实现

探索利用新型并行计算技术,如光子计算、生物计算、类脑计算等,实现大数减法的并行计算。研究新型并行计算技术的特点和优势,并将其应用于大数减法算法的并行化实现。开发新型并行计算技术与大数减法算法的并行化实现相结合的混合并行算法,以进一步提高计算效率。

以上策略都是为了充分利用现代计算机硬件的并行性,从而大大提高大数减法运算的效率。

中视教育资讯网官网www.edu.ccutv.cn/更多资讯....


阅读全文

  标签:教育资讯  科普在线  书画园地  百业信息  中视教育资讯网官方